Crimson Desert Developer Fulfills Promise, Replaces AI Art in Recent Patch

For those displeased by the presence of AI-generated imagery in the game, there’s good news for Crimson Desert players: the controversial artwork has been officially replaced. As part of the game’s latest significant update, released over the weekend, developer Pearl Abyss has systematically removed all AI assets from the title.

While this crucial change was mentioned within the comprehensive patch notes, it required a short period for players to thoroughly confirm that every instance of AI-generated content had indeed been successfully swapped out for new, human-created alternatives.
